Over 41,000 Automobiles Assembled in 11 Months
Automobile manufacturers in
In November, automakers are forecast to turn out 4,699 automobiles, down 8.2 per cent compared with the same period last year.
They produced 36,397 cars in the January-October period.
Foreign-invested firms led the auto industry, with 33,389 units in the eleven-month period (down 5 per cent on year) and 3,962 in November, the private sector turned out 863 (up 43.4 per cent) and 115 (up 35.3 per cent), respectively, and the state-owned sector produced 6,844 (up 20.9 per cent) and 622 (down 12.7 per cent), respectively.
Eleven foreign-led automobile assemblers sold 4,863 automobiles in October, bringing their total in the January-October period to 27,310 units, down 9.3 per cent on-year.
